Microsoft has disabled a fix for a BitLocker security feature bypass vulnerability due to firmware incompatibility issues that were causing patched Windows devices to go into BitLocker recovery mode.
As BitLocker requires Secure Boot, Lambertz also had to start the Linux used for the exploit with Secure Boot. Lambertz emphasized that Microsoft has been aware of the problem for a long time.
